package com.amazonaws.services.quicksight.model;

import java.io.Serializable;
import javax.annotation.Generated;
import com.amazonaws.protocol.StructuredPojo;
import com.amazonaws.protocol.ProtocolMarshaller;

/**
 * <p>
 * The configuration of a scatter plot.
 * </p>
 * 
 * @see <a href="http://docs.aws.amazon.com/goto/WebAPI/quicksight-2018-04-01/ScatterPlotConfiguration"
 *      target="_top">AWS API Documentation</a>
 */
@Generated("com.amazonaws:aws-java-sdk-code-generator")
public class ScatterPlotConfiguration implements Serializable, Cloneable, StructuredPojo {

    /**
     * <p>
     * The field wells of the visual.
     * </p>
     */
    private ScatterPlotFieldWells fieldWells;
    /**
     * <p>
     * The label options (label text, label visibility, and sort icon visibility) of the scatter plot's x-axis.
     * </p>
     */
    private ChartAxisLabelOptions xAxisLabelOptions;
    /**
     * <p>
     * The label display options (grid line, range, scale, and axis step) of the scatter plot's x-axis.
     * </p>
     */
    private AxisDisplayOptions xAxisDisplayOptions;
    /**
     * <p>
     * The label options (label text, label visibility, and sort icon visibility) of the scatter plot's y-axis.
     * </p>
     */
    private ChartAxisLabelOptions yAxisLabelOptions;
    /**
     * <p>
     * The label display options (grid line, range, scale, and axis step) of the scatter plot's y-axis.
     * </p>
     */
    private AxisDisplayOptions yAxisDisplayOptions;
    /**
     * <p>
     * The legend display setup of the visual.
     * </p>
     */
    private LegendOptions legend;
    /**
     * <p>
     * The options that determine if visual data labels are displayed.
     * </p>
     */
    private DataLabelOptions dataLabels;
    /**
     * <p>
     * The legend display setup of the visual.
     * </p>
     */
    private TooltipOptions tooltip;
    /**
     * <p>
     * The palette (chart color) display setup of the visual.
     * </p>
     */
    private VisualPalette visualPalette;
